Who was Thomas Wilkes?

Sir Thomas Wilkes was an English civil servant and diplomat during the reign of Elizabeth I of England. He served as Clerk of the Privy Council, Member of Parliament for Downton and Southampton, and English member of the Council of State of the Netherlands, and on many diplomatic missions for the English government.
